1 month agoChina’s Mars Rover Finds Evidence of GIGANTIC "Ancient Ocean" on MarsBeyond ScienceVerified
1 month agoS27E139: Australia's Rocket Renaissance, Cosmic Giants Unveiled, and Martian Ocean MysteriesSpaceTime with Stuart Gary